WebKashechewan First Nation and Canada will each name two (2) representatives to the Steering Committee. Ontario’s Ministry of Indigenous Affairs will name one representative. The Steering Committee will provide an annual report to Canada, Ontario, and Kashechewan First Nation on the progress made under this Framework Agreement. Web19 de jan. de 2024 · The furs were underpriced, he says, and most fell into debt. I walk past $30 frozen pizzas and $15 cartons of eggs. At the fruit and veggie section, a bunch of grapes (79 grams or about 100 grapes) costs $13.42, a bag of apples (three pounds of Golden Delicious) is $15.29, and a single head of red cabbage is $12.89.
